More about Master of Clinical Audiology
Are you considering advancing your career in audiology? The Master of Clinical Audiology course available in Bacchus Marsh, 3340 Australia, offers an excellent opportunity to deepen your understanding and enhance your skills in this vital healthcare field. With various training providers in the local area, aspiring audiologists can benefit from a hands-on learning experience while enjoying the convenience of studying close to home.
Two reputable training providers in Bacchus Marsh are The University of Melbourne and La Trobe University. Both institutions offer the Master of Clinical Audiology through an On Campus delivery mode, which allows students to engage directly with experienced faculty and collaborate with peers.
